• Subject: RE: Granting another group profile
  • From: "Richard Casey" <casey_r@xxxxxxxxxxxxxxxx>
  • Date: Wed, 28 Feb 2001 12:50:19 -0500
  • Importance: Normal

Gord,

I goofed on that code (knew I should have tested it!).
See my updated version when it gets posted to the list.

Basically, instead of this:

              CHGVAR     VAR(&SUPGRPPRF) +
                         VALUE(&USER *CAT %SST(&SUPGRPPRF 1 140))
              CHGUSRPRF  USRPRF(&GRPLIST) SUPGRPPRF(&SUPGRPPRF)

use this:
              DCL        VAR(&CMD) TYPE(*CHAR) LEN(200)
              ...
              CHGVAR     VAR(&CMD) +
                         VALUE('CHGUSRPRF USRPRF(' *TCAT &GRPLIST *TCAT +
                         ') SUPGRPPRF(' *TCAT &USER *BCAT +
                         %SST(&SUPGRPPRF 1 140) *TCAT ')')
              CALL       PGM(QCMDEXC) PARM(&CMD 200)

Hope this helps!
Richard

-----Original Message-----
From: owner-midrange-l@midrange.com
[mailto:owner-midrange-l@midrange.com]On Behalf Of Gord Hutchinson
Sent: Wednesday, February 28, 2001 11:54 AM
To: MIDRANGE-L@midrange.com
Subject: Re: Granting another group profile


On Wed, 28 Feb 2001 10:55:59 -0500, "Richard Casey"
<casey_r@popmail.firn.edu>
wrote:

>/* Add profile to current supplemental profile list. */
>              CHGVAR     VAR(&SUPGRPPRF) +
>                         VALUE(&USER *CAT %SST(&SUPGRPPRF 1 140))
>              CHGUSRPRF  USRPRF(&GRPLIST) SUPGRPPRF(&SUPGRPPRF)
>              GOTO       CMDLBL(GETREC)
>

Coincidentally,  I am trying to do the same thing.  What I have done is a
DSPUSRPRF to an outfile.  I am then changing &UPSUPG to include the new
group
profile.  Unfortunately, when I do the CHGUSRPRF, I am getting CPD0078 -
"Value
'OEXGROUP   ' for parameter SUPGRPPRF not a valid name".  OEXGROUP is the
first
of 4 groups currently in SUPGRPPRF (I am trying to add a 5th).

Gord


--
Gord Hutchinson
Database Administrator
TST Overland Express
ghutchinson@tstoverland.com
905-212-6330
fax: 905-602-8895

+---
| This is the Midrange System Mailing List!
| To submit a new message, send your mail to MIDRANGE-L@midrange.com.
| To subscribe to this list send email to MIDRANGE-L-SUB@midrange.com.
| To unsubscribe from this list send email to MIDRANGE-L-UNSUB@midrange.com.
| Questions should be directed to the list owner/operator: david@midrange.com
+---

As an Amazon Associate we earn from qualifying purchases.

This thread ...

Replies:

Follow On AppleNews
Return to Archive home page | Return to MIDRANGE.COM home page

This mailing list archive is Copyright 1997-2024 by midrange.com and David Gibbs as a compilation work. Use of the archive is restricted to research of a business or technical nature. Any other uses are prohibited. Full details are available on our policy page. If you have questions about this, please contact [javascript protected email address].

Operating expenses for this site are earned using the Amazon Associate program and Google Adsense.